Day 68 Fort Fisher Recreation Center - located at 1000 Loggerhead Road, Kure Beach, NC 28449.
The season will soon be winding down so don't forget to visit the ocean shore and this recreation area....Lots to do, swim, fish, 4 wheel it, search the beach for t reassures or simply sit back and enjoy the wildlife around you. This is one of the most beautiful beaches in the area and there is a lotsto do.
There are salt marshes, tidal creeks and mud flats for you to explore. Be sure to check out their web site to know what is going on http://www.ncparks.gov/Visit/parks/fofi/main.php

Day 40 Fort Fisher Second Saturdays - We have already visited the Fort Fisher Civil War Museum in our journey of 365 Things to Do in Wilmington and the Cape Fear Region....but of note is that every second Saturday you can explore historical Fort Fisher's historical landscape. From 10-4 on each second Saturday and the next one Saturday June 12, 2010-----you can visit the area and experience period music, educational talks and demonstrations, participate in costume guided tour and more. For more info go to www.nchistoricsites.org/fisher/.. Demonstrators and vendors will exhibit and sell their seascapes and landscapes .....you can see into the past history of the area and watch demonstrations by North State Rifles...This initiative is part of NC's Second Saturdays which is intended to bring people out to the historic sites in NC and get people excited about local art....
